Velan Inc. (TSX:VLN)
Canada flag Canada · Delayed Price · Currency is CAD
14.50
+0.30 (2.11%)
Jan 29, 2026, 3:23 PM EST

Velan Ratios and Metrics

Millions CAD. Fiscal year is Mar - Feb.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Feb '25 Feb '24 Feb '23 Feb '22 Feb '21 2016 - 2020
307324111275209168
Upgrade
Market Cap Growth
28.97%190.70%-59.50%31.88%23.85%11.33%
Upgrade
Enterprise Value
306309119275190151
Upgrade
Last Close Price
14.2014.464.9712.239.247.46
Upgrade
PE Ratio
70.62----46.24
Upgrade
PS Ratio
0.740.760.320.550.400.44
Upgrade
PB Ratio
1.182.270.451.010.620.44
Upgrade
P/TBV Ratio
1.222.440.501.100.660.47
Upgrade
P/FCF Ratio
-11.9612.46-14.04-
Upgrade
P/OCF Ratio
-8.466.59387.219.21-
Upgrade
EV/Sales Ratio
0.740.720.340.550.360.39
Upgrade
EV/EBITDA Ratio
10.998.54-6.213.0079.20
Upgrade
EV/EBIT Ratio
19.8511.78-8.483.71-
Upgrade
EV/FCF Ratio
-1.2011.4013.36-12.78-
Upgrade
Debt / Equity Ratio
0.210.250.230.200.170.28
Upgrade
Debt / EBITDA Ratio
1.990.92-1.200.8525.52
Upgrade
Debt / FCF Ratio
-1.336.29-3.76-
Upgrade
Asset Turnover
0.690.600.540.750.760.54
Upgrade
Inventory Turnover
1.371.220.991.211.301.22
Upgrade
Quick Ratio
1.040.291.111.351.221.25
Upgrade
Current Ratio
2.341.122.412.832.672.41
Upgrade
Return on Equity (ROE)
1.93%-47.84%-16.68%-23.78%-3.62%0.75%
Upgrade
Return on Assets (ROA)
1.62%2.31%-1.10%3.02%4.63%-1.00%
Upgrade
Return on Invested Capital (ROIC)
6.36%14.11%-4.73%11.24%-4.23%-3.07%
Upgrade
Return on Capital Employed (ROCE)
4.90%14.20%-2.60%7.00%11.40%-2.20%
Upgrade
Earnings Yield
29.78%-33.65%-24.05%-27.43%-12.85%2.16%
Upgrade
FCF Yield
-83.00%8.36%8.02%-1.90%7.12%-14.26%
Upgrade
Dividend Yield
2.82%0.20%0.55%---
Upgrade
Payout Ratio
13.40%----16.81%
Upgrade
Buyback Yield / Dilution
-----0.14%
Upgrade
Total Shareholder Return
2.70%0.20%0.55%--0.14%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.